We had lunch at a service area by the side of the road in the Jezreel Valley. After several days of strict Kosher food (over passover) this restaurant with fresh bread and pork was a welcome surprise. | |
Also known as the Plain of Armageddon the area didn't have the menace or devastation you might expect. In fact, the setting was very pleasant with flowers everywhere. | |
We were here because we were on the way to Nazareth. Again the local tensions are very apparent from the languages on the road signs. | |
This small town on the hillside overlooked the road and services where we stopped. |
